Analysis

Rwanda recorded 8.9% for unemployment with basic education, male in 2024.

The figure is down 11.5% on the previous year and up 1,348.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, unemployment with basic education, male in Rwanda peaked at 13.6%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 0.6%, in 2014.

That places Rwanda 41st out of 130 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

Unemployment with basic education, male in Rwanda, year by year

Annual values for Unemployment with basic education, male (% of male labor force with basic education) in Rwanda, 2014 to 2024.
Year % of male labor force with basic education Change
2014 0.6%
2017 10.0% +1528.5%
2018 9.2% -7.7%
2019 9.5% +2.9%
2020 9.8% +3.8%
2021 13.6% +38.5%
2022 12.5% -8.0%
2023 10.1% -19.9%
2024 8.9% -11.5%

The percentage of the labor force with a basic level of education who are unemployed. Basic education comprises primary education or lower secondary education according to the International Standard Classification of Education 2011 (ISCED 2011).
